How Cambodia became the first Asian country to hit an elusive HIV target

How Cambodia became the first Asian country to hit an elusive HIV targetWorldPing

The United Nations has set a goal for near universal HIV diagnosis and treatment for all by 2030. No country in Asia has hit the mark — until this year.
